Warning Signs You Need Wood Trim Water Damage Restoration

Water damage to wood trim can be a sneaky threat, hiding in plain sight until it’s too late. Don’t ignore these warning signs as they can show a more significant problem brewing beneath the surface: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Unpleasant odors can be a sign of moisture accumulation, which can lead to mold growth and further damage. Don’t wait until the smell becomes unbearable address the issue quickly to prevent costly repairs and health risks.

Warping or Warped Woodwork

Warped wood trim can be a sign of water damage, which can compromise your home’s structure and appearance. Don’t ignore this warning sign address the issue qu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s.

Visible Water Stains

Water stains can be a sign of water damage, which can lead to mold growth and further decay. Don’t ignore this warning sign address the issue quickly to prevent costly repairs and health risks.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age, which can compromise your home’s appearance and structure. Don’t ignore this warning sign address the issue qu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s.

Unusual Sounds or Creaks

Unusual sounds or creaks can be a sign of water damage, which can compromise your home’s structure and safety. Don’t ignore this warning sign address the issue qu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s.

Wood Trim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water stain on a single piece of wood trim Yes No DIY cleaning and restoration can be effective for minor issues.
Visible water damage on multiple pieces of wood trim No Yes Professional assessment and restoration are necessary to prevent further damage and ensure a thorough clean.
Musty odors or warping woodwork No Yes These signs show a more significant issue that needs professional attention to prevent health risks and costly repairs.
Water damage from a leaky pipe or clogged drain No Yes Professional help is necessary to identify and address the root cause of the issue and prevent further damage.
Water damage from a flood or natural disaster No Yes Professional help is necessary to assess and address the damage, ensuring a safe and healthy environment for your family.
Water damage that’s been neglected or ignored No Yes Professional help is necessary to address the issue quickly and prevent further damage, costly repairs, and health risks.

Common Questions About Wood Trim Water Damage Restoration

Q: How long does the restoration process take?

A: The length of the restoration process depends on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and the complexity of the restoration process. Typically, it takes 3-5 days to complete the work, but this can vary depending on the specifics of the job.

Q: Will I need to replace all the wood trim?

A: Not necessarily. Our team will assess the damage and find out the extent of the issue. In some cases, we may be able to restore the wood trim to its original condition, while in others, replacement may be necessary. We’ll work with you to find out the best course of action.

Q: Is wood trim water damage covered by insurance?

A: Yes, wood trim water damage is typically covered by insurance. But, the process of filing a claim can be complex and our team is here to help you navigate it. We’ll work with your insurance company to ensure you receive the compensation you deserve.

Q: Can I prevent wood trim water damage?

A: Yes, there are steps you can take to prevent wood trim water damage. Regular inspections and maintenance can help identify potential issues before they become major problems. We recommend checking your wood trim regularly for signs of water damage, such as warping, cracking, or discoloration.
